Creamy Mushroom Asparagus Pasta (Anti-Inflammatory Recipe)

Description

This Creamy Mushroom Asparagus Pasta is a wholesome, anti-inflammatory comfort food made with tender penne pasta, earthy mushrooms, crisp asparagus, and a rich creamy sauce. By using ingredients known for their antioxidant and anti-inflammatory properties, this dish delivers both flavor and nutrition.

Perfect for a healthy weeknight dinner, meal prep, or family gathering, this recipe combines fiber-rich vegetables, immune-supporting garlic, and heart-healthy olive oil into a satisfying meal.

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 25 minutes
Total Time: 40 minutes
Servings: 4


Ingredients

For the Pasta

  • 12 oz (340g) penne pasta
  • 1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
  • 1 bunch asparagus, trimmed and cut into 2-inch pieces
  • 8 oz (225g) cremini or button mushrooms, sliced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 small onion, finely diced

For the Creamy Sauce

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 cup unsweetened almond milk
  • ½ cup low-sodium vegetable broth
  • ½ cup plain Greek yogurt
  • 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 teaspoon turmeric powder
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 teaspoon sea salt
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ice

Optional Protein Additions

  • 2 cups shredded chicken breast
  • 1 cup chickpeas
  • 8 oz grilled salmon pieces

Garnish

  • Fresh parsley, chopped
  • Extra black pepper
  • Lemon zest

Instructions

Step 1: Cook the Pasta

  1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il.
  2. Cook penne pasta according to package directions until al dente.
  3. Reserve ½ cup pasta water.
  4. Drain and set aside.

Step 2: Sauté the Vegetables

  1.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
  2. Add onions and cook for 3 minutes.
  3. Stir in garlic and cook for 30 seconds.
  4. Add mushrooms and cook for 5–6 minutes until browned.
  5. Add asparagus and cook for another 4 minutes.

Step 3: Prepare the Anti-Inflammatory Sauce

  1. In a bowl, whisk together:
    • Almond milk
    • Vegetable broth
    • Greek yogurt
    • Parmesan cheese
    • Turmeric
    • Black pepper
    • Thyme
    • Lemon juice
  2. Pour mixture into the skillet.
  3. Simmer for 3–4 minutes until slightly thickened.

Step 4: Combine Everything

  1. Add cooked pasta to the skillet.
  2. Toss until evenly coated.
  3. Add reserved pasta water if needed.
  4. Stir in your preferred protein if using.

Step 5: Serve

  1. Garnish with parsley and lemon zest.
  2. Serve immediately while warm.

Why This Recipe Is Anti-Inflammatory

Several ingredients in this dish are associated with anti-inflammatory benefits:

Turmeric

Contains curcumin, a powerful antioxidant that may help support healthy inflammatory responses.

Mushrooms

Rich in antioxidants and immune-supporting compounds.

Asparagus

Provides fiber, folate, and anti-inflammatory phytonutrients.

Garlic

Contains sulfur compounds that support immune health.

Extra Virgin Olive Oil

A staple of heart-healthy Mediterranean eating patterns.

Lemon Juice

Adds vitamin C and enhances flavor naturally.

Recipe Variations

Vegan Version

Replace:

  • Greek yogurt → cashew cream
  • Parmesan → nutritional yeast

Gluten-Free Version

Use:

  • Gluten-free penne pasta
  • Chickpea pasta
  • Brown rice pasta

High-Protein Version

Add:

  • Grilled chicken
  • Turkey breast
  • White beans
  • Tofu cubes

Mediterranean Version

Mix in:

  • Spinach
  • Sun-dried tomatoes
  • Artichoke hearts
  • Kalamata olives

Low-Carb Version

Replace pasta with:

  • Zucchini noodles
  • Hearts of palm pasta
  • Spaghetti squash

Storage Instructions

Refrigerator

Store in an airtight container for up to 4 days.

Freezer

Freeze for up to 2 months.

Reheating

Warm gently on the stovetop with a splash of broth or almond milk.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I make this recipe ahead of time?

Yes. Prepare the entire dish up to 2 days ahead and reheat before serving.

What mushrooms work best?

Cremini, baby bella, button, shiitake, or a mixed mushroom blend all work well.

Can I use milk instead of almond milk?

Yes. Dairy milk, oat milk, or cashew milk can be substituted.

Is this recipe good for weight management?

It can be part of a balanced diet, especially when paired with lean protein and portion control.

Can I add more vegetables?

Absolutely. Spinach, kale, broccoli, peas, and zucchini all complement the recipe.

How can I increase protein?

Add chicken breast, salmon, shrimp, tofu, tempeh, or white beans.
